Withdrawal, Consent, and the Limits of ICC Jurisdiction: The Duterte Case

View Full Paper
MMMorris Kiwinda MbondenyiKabarak University

Key Points

  • The aim is to examine the complexities of ICC jurisdiction concerning withdrawal and consent, specifically in the Duterte case.
  • Analysis of treaty design
  • Comparison of institutional legitimacy
  • Evaluation of criminal responsibility versus adjudicative jurisdiction
  • Identified limitations in ICC jurisdiction linked to states' withdrawal
  • Highlighted the significance of consent in treaty obligations
  • Clarified the distinction between types of jurisdiction in international law

Abstract

A Policy Brief on Treaty Design, Institutional Legitimacy, and the Distinction Between Criminal Responsibility and Adjudicative Jurisdiction
